Silverknowes is a well-established residential neighbourhood situated north-west of Edinburgh city centre. Local amenities are available along Silverknowes Road, with further conveniences in the nearby village of Davidson's Mains, including a Tesco Metro, Boots, banks, and a post office. Craigleith Retail Park is also within easy reach, offering a wider range of high-street stores such as Sainsbury’s, Marks & Spencer, and Homebase. The area benefits from access to scenic open spaces and walking routes at Cramond Shore and Corstorphine Hill. A variety of highly regarded state and private schools cater to all educational levels. For commuters, the A90 provides a direct route north to the Forth Road Bridge, while the city bypass is approximately four miles away, ensuring good road connections.
